Basement flood restoration services involve the process of cleaning up and repairing a basement after water damage has occurred. This typically includes removing standing water, drying out affected areas, and addressing any resulting issues such as mold growth or structural damage. Service providers use specialized equipment to ensure thorough drying and dehumidification, helping to prevent further problems that can arise from lingering moisture. The goal is to restore the basement to a safe, dry condition that minimizes the risk of future water-related issues.

These services are essential when dealing with various water intrusion problems, such as burst pipes, heavy rains, or sewer backups. Water damage can lead to serious issues like warped flooring, weakened walls, and mold growth, which can pose health risks and compromise the integrity of the property. Basement flood restoration helps homeowners eliminate these hazards by thoroughly cleaning, sanitizing, and repairing affected areas. This process not only restores the appearance of the space but also helps protect the home’s structure and the health of its occupants.

The overview below groups typical Basement Flood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in West Bend, WI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Minor Repairs - Typical costs for small-scale basement flood repairs, such as sealing cracks or replacing a few floor tiles,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age.

Moderate Restoration - For more extensive work like replacing drywall, flooring, or addressing mold, local contractors often charge between $1,000-$3,000. Larger projects are less common but can reach up to $5,000+ for complex cases.

Full Basement Flood Restoration - Complete overhaul of a flooded basement, including waterproofing, sump pump installation, and structural repairs, typically costs $5,000-$15,000. Many projects stay within this range, though very large or complicated jobs can exceed it.

Water Extraction and Cleanup - Basic water removal and drying services usually cost between $250-$800, with many jobs completed in this range. More extensive cleanup involving mold remediation or structural drying can push costs higher, up to $2,000 or more.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es basement flooding? Basement flooding can result from heavy rain, plumbing leaks, or poor drainage systems that allow water to seep into the foundation area.

How can I tell if my basement has a water problem? Signs include water stains, musty odors, mold growth, or visible pooling of water after rain or plumbing issues.

What services do contractors offer for basement flood restoration? Local contractors typically provide water extraction, drying and dehumidification, mold remediation, and foundation repairs.

Are there preventative measures to avoid future flooding? Yes, options include installing sump pumps, improving drainage around the property, and sealing cracks in the foundation.
